Increased Focus on Sustainability and ESG Investing

Another significant trend in Yahoo Finance is the growing emphasis on sustainability and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) factors in investing. As more investors seek to align their portfolios with their values, Yahoo Finance has responded by providing comprehensive ESG ratings and metrics for various companies. This feature allows users to assess how well a company performs in areas that matter beyond just financial returns.

Investors can now filter stocks based on their ESG performance, making it easier to find investments that reflect their ethical considerations. This trend not only underscores the importance of responsible investing but also enhances the functionality of Yahoo Finance as a holistic financial resource.
